Posted January 18, 20169 yr After harsh battles, the polar warriors will retreat to this remote spa that offers a steamy sauna and a hot bath. Located near the coast it also offers the opportunity to have a cool swim after the sauna. The spa facility is guarded by elite polar warrior guards to make sure no Elken tribe warriors disturb this peaceful place.
